IN RE: | HB2267 by Hodge (Relating to the joint or separate prosecution of a capital felony charged against two or more defendants and the extent of a defendant's criminal responsibility for the conduct of a coconspirator in capital felony cases.), As Engrossed |
The costs of adjudicating two or more capital trials for two or more defendants rather than only one trial may have a fiscal implication for any particular jurisdiction. Because this estimate assumes such circumstances would be infrequent, no significant implication to units of local government statewide is anticipated.
